META-INF.modules.java.desktop.classes.sun.awt.X11GraphicsEnvironment.class Maven / Gradle / Ivy
???? 8 C ? C ? C ? C ?
D ? ?
?
C ? ? ?
?
C ? C ?
? ?
C ?
! ?
? ?
! ?
C ? ? ?
?
? ? ? ?
?
C ?
C ?
?
? ?
? ?
C ?
C ?
D ?
C ?
D ? C ?
C ? C ? ? ?
? ? ?
? ?
C ?
C ? ? ? ? ? ? ? ? ? ? ? ? ?
? ? ? ? ? ?
? ? C ? ? ?
> ? ?
@ ?
? ? ? ? InnerClasses log !Lsun/util/logging/PlatformLogger; screenLog
xinerState Ljava/lang/Boolean; glxAvailable Z
glxVerbose xRenderVerbose xRenderAvailable isDisplayLocal initGLX ()Z isGLXAvailable Code LineNumberTable isGLXVerbose initXRender (ZZ)Z isXRenderAvailable isXRenderVerbose checkShmExt ()I getDisplayString ()Ljava/lang/String; initDisplay (Z)V ()V LocalVariableTable this Lsun/awt/X11GraphicsEnvironment;
getNumScreens makeScreenDevice (I)Ljava/awt/GraphicsDevice; screennum I getDefaultScreenNum getDefaultScreenDevice ()Ljava/awt/GraphicsDevice; screens [Ljava/awt/GraphicsDevice; index
StackMapTable o ? _isDisplayLocal isRemote Ljava/lang/String; shm display ind hostName result getDefaultFontFaceName pRunningXinerama getXineramaCenterPoint ()Ljava/awt/Point; getCenterPoint p Ljava/awt/Point; getMaximumWindowBounds ()Ljava/awt/Rectangle; runningXinerama getXineramaWindowBounds tempRect Ljava/awt/Rectangle; center unionRect gds centerMonitorRect i ? ? paletteChanged
SourceFile X11GraphicsEnvironment.java NestMembers K L M L O L N L a b sun/awt/X11GraphicsDevice a ? ? ? java/awt/AWTError no screen devices a ? k \ P J ? ? b t R ? ? ? b ? R ? R %sun/security/action/GetPropertyAction sun.java2d.remote ? ? ? java/lang/String false ? ? [ \ ] ^ ? ? ? ? sun/awt/X11GraphicsEnvironment$2 java/lang/Boolean ? R ~ ? ? ? ? ? I J } R H G ? ? ? ? ? ? BootstrapMethods ? ? ? ? ? ? ? ? ? j j j j 6Video Wall: center point is at center of all displays. VCenter point at center of a particular monitor, but not of the entire virtual display. ?Center point is somewhere strange - return union of all bounds. sun.awt.X11GraphicsEnvironment F G %sun.awt.screen.X11GraphicsEnvironment sun/awt/X11GraphicsEnvironment$1 $sun/java2d/UnixSurfaceManagerFactory sun/awt/X11GraphicsEnvironment !sun/java2d/SunGraphicsEnvironment java/lang/Throwable java/awt/Point java/awt/Rectangle (I)V getScreenDevices ()[Ljava/awt/GraphicsDevice; (Ljava/lang/String;)V sun/awt/SunToolkit awtLock valueOf (Z)Ljava/lang/Boolean; awtUnlock booleanValue
isHeadless java/security/AccessController doPrivileged 4(Ljava/security/PrivilegedAction;)Ljava/lang/Object; equals (Ljava/lang/Object;)Z indexOf (I)I substring (II)Ljava/lang/String; %sun/util/logging/PlatformLogger$Level Level FINER 'Lsun/util/logging/PlatformLogger$Level; sun/util/logging/PlatformLogger
isLoggable *(Lsun/util/logging/PlatformLogger$Level;)Z
Running Xinerama: makeConcatWithConstants '(Ljava/lang/Boolean;)Ljava/lang/String; finer getUsableBounds /(Ljava/awt/GraphicsDevice;)Ljava/awt/Rectangle; width x height y union *(Ljava/awt/Rectangle;)Ljava/awt/Rectangle; getLogger 5(Ljava/lang/String;)Lsun/util/logging/PlatformLogger; sun/java2d/SurfaceManagerFactory setInstance %(Lsun/java2d/SurfaceManagerFactory;)V ? $java/lang/invoke/StringConcatFactory Lookup ?(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/invoke/CallSite; %java/lang/invoke/MethodHandles$Lookup java/lang/invoke/MethodHandles 1 C D F G H G
I J
K L
M L
N L
O L P J
Q R S R T ? ? U ? V R T ? ? U ?
W X Y R T ? ? U ? Z R T ? ? U ?
[ \
] ^
_ ` a b T 3 *? ? U
? ? c d e f \ g h T = ? Y? ? U ? c d e i j k \ l m T ? ,*? L+??
? Y
? ?*? =+?
+?? ? 2? U ? ?
? ? ? c , d e ' n o p j q + ? r? C r r? C r r P R T ? /*?
? #? *?
?
*? ? ?
? ? L? +?*?
? ?
! U &